Office Preferences - Middle East

Do MBB Dubai offices review applications that list Dubai as a second preference? I am based in London and wondering whether to list Dubai as first or second given the competition in the UK. I know London offices do not look at applications which list London as a second preference - could you confirm if this is the case for Dubai?

Hi Anonymous,

For non-experienced hires usually there is only 1 review of your application in the office for which you apply. Since it's a global recruiting system, that makes sense - why to review the same application twice and congest the recruiting system, if there is a (more or less) global standard for checking applications.

For experienced hires with a highly specific skillset it is sometimes reviewed in other offices as well, since it's a small number of 'exceptions' to the majority of applicants and those people are not easily interchangable (because of their specific skillset), so it is good to check demand  for them in more detail across offices.

Hi there,

I'd recommend you do not take those considerations into account. You can have two approaches for selecting your office:

  1. Go with the office in the city where you want to live or the one where you industry of preference is developed
  2. Go with the option where you have more chances to get an offer

No one can give you a response for your question, it will be a pure speculation, so you'd better focus on one of the two approached above.

I agree with both Medhi and the anonymous response.

You seriously need to apply to the office where you legitimately want to work and think you have the highest chance of success.

In relation to this, where do you have the most work experience? Where do you have work rights? Which is your native language? Where have you networked?

^that's where you should list as a first preference.
